Geely
Geely is a major Chinese carmaker. It sells vehicles under its own brands, including Geely Auto, Geometry, Livan and Zeekr. In 2010, Geely acquired Volvo from Ford, and it purchased a majority stake in the Lotus brand in 2017. It also operates the Smart brand under a joint venture with Mercedes-Benz.
